X+3 divided by X2 + X-6

Respuesta :

mysticchacha
mysticchacha mysticchacha
  • 05-05-2020

Answer:

=1/(x-2)

Step-by-step explanation:

X+3 divided by X2 + X-6

= [x + 3] / [ x^2  + x  - 6]

factor the denominator

We can use the X-method of factoring the trinomial.

so.

x^2  + x - 6 =  ( x +3)(x - 2)    since   3*-2 = -6 and 3 - 2 = 1

so

= [x + 3] / [ x^2  + x  - 6]

=(x + 3)/(x + 3)(x - 2)

= 1/(x-2)
